From b191ba0d599928372be5a89f75486eb58efab48a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Evgeniy Polyakov Date: Mon, 20 Mar 2006 22:21:40 -0800 Subject: [CONNECTOR]: Use netlink_has_listeners() to avoind unnecessary allocations. Return -ESRCH from cn_netlink_send() when there are not listeners, just as it could be done by netlink_broadcast(). Propagate netlink_broadcast() error back to the caller.
